Key Insights

The global tin-plated copper alloy wire market is experiencing robust growth, driven by the increasing demand from diverse sectors like electronics, automotive, and communication. The market's expansion is fueled by the material's superior conductivity, corrosion resistance, and solderability, making it indispensable in various applications. While precise market sizing data was not provided, based on industry analyses of similar wire markets and considering a typical CAGR for specialized wire products of around 5-7%, we can reasonably estimate the 2025 market size to be in the range of $2-3 billion USD. This estimation considers factors such as the increasing adoption of electric vehicles and the growth of 5G infrastructure, both of which significantly increase demand. The market is segmented by wire thickness (thin-plated and thick-plated) and application, with electronics and automotive leading the segments. Growth in the electronics industry, particularly in areas like printed circuit boards and microelectronics, contributes significantly to market demand. The automotive sector's shift towards electric and hybrid vehicles further boosts the demand for tin-plated copper alloy wires due to their use in electric motors, wiring harnesses, and battery systems. Competition among major players like American Elements, MWS Wire Industries, and others is intensifying, leading to innovation in wire production techniques and material compositions to enhance performance and cost-effectiveness. Geographic distribution showcases strong growth in Asia Pacific, propelled by the rapid industrialization and technological advancements in countries like China and India. While supply chain disruptions and fluctuations in raw material prices pose potential restraints, the overall outlook for the tin-plated copper alloy wire market remains positive, with significant growth projected over the next decade. This growth trajectory is expected to be influenced by continuing advancements in the manufacturing of higher performance electronic devices that rely heavily on superior electrical and mechanical properties, thus driving adoption of this material.

Driving Forces: What's Propelling the Tin-Plated Copper Alloy Wire Market?

Several key factors are fueling the growth of the tin-plated copper alloy wire market. The escalating demand from the electronics and electrical industry, particularly in consumer electronics, power transmission, and renewable energy sectors, is a major driver. The automotive industry's shift towards electric and hybrid vehicles is significantly boosting demand for tin-plated copper alloy wires due to their use in electric motors, battery systems, and charging infrastructure. Similarly, the expansion of 5G networks and the increasing adoption of advanced communication technologies are creating new opportunities for market growth. The superior electrical conductivity and corrosion resistance of tin-plated copper alloy wires compared to alternatives, coupled with their ease of soldering, make them highly desirable across diverse applications. Furthermore, ongoing advancements in manufacturing technologies are leading to improved wire quality, enhanced performance characteristics, and cost optimization, further propelling market expansion. The increasing focus on miniaturization in electronics, requiring thinner and more flexible wires, is also a key driver. Finally, the growing preference for high-quality and reliable components across various industries is stimulating the demand for tin-plated copper alloy wires, securing their position as a preferred material in numerous applications.

Challenges and Restraints in Tin-Plated Copper Alloy Wire Market

Despite the positive growth outlook, the tin-plated copper alloy wire market faces certain challenges. Fluctuations in the prices of raw materials, particularly copper and tin, pose a significant risk to manufacturers' profitability and can impact product pricing. Stringent environmental regulations regarding the disposal and recycling of electronic waste containing copper and tin can add to the operational costs and complexity for manufacturers. Furthermore, the emergence of alternative materials with comparable properties, such as aluminum wires, presents competitive pressure. Competition from manufacturers in developing economies offering lower-priced products can also impact market dynamics. Maintaining consistent quality control throughout the manufacturing process is crucial, as any defects can have significant consequences in applications demanding high reliability. Furthermore, advancements in material science could potentially lead to the development of superior alternatives to tin-plated copper alloy wire, posing a long-term challenge. Finally, global economic slowdowns can negatively impact demand across various industry segments, affecting market growth.

Key Region or Country & Segment to Dominate the Market

The Electronics and Electrical Industry segment is projected to dominate the tin-plated copper alloy wire market throughout the forecast period, driven by the continuous growth in electronic devices, smart home applications, and the ongoing expansion of renewable energy infrastructure. This segment is expected to account for approximately XXX million units by 2033.

  • Asia-Pacific: This region is expected to lead the market, driven by robust economic growth, rapid industrialization, and substantial investments in infrastructure development. Countries like China, India, and Japan are key contributors to this regional dominance. Their burgeoning electronics manufacturing sectors, coupled with significant expansion in automotive and communication industries, are pivotal factors driving market growth. The large consumer base and rising disposable incomes in these countries also contribute significantly.

  • North America: While holding a strong market share, North America's growth rate is anticipated to be more moderate compared to Asia-Pacific. This is largely attributable to its mature electronics and automotive industries, although ongoing innovation and adoption of new technologies continue to generate demand.

  • Europe: The European market is expected to witness steady growth driven by investments in renewable energy infrastructure and the focus on sustainable manufacturing practices. However, stringent environmental regulations and relatively slower economic growth compared to Asia-Pacific might restrain the market’s expansion.

  • Thin-Plated Tin-Copper Wire: This type of wire is gaining significant traction due to its suitability for miniaturized electronic components and its cost-effectiveness. The demand for thinner wires in increasingly compact devices is expected to fuel its market share. The growth in the electronics and consumer electronics segments directly impacts the demand for thin-plated wires.
